When we detect a new phy being added, we schedule a filtered dump of
WIPHYs and INTERFACES. However, the processing of these dumps was
shared with the global dump of all WIPHYs and INTERFACEs which is
performed at startup. This normally worked fine as long as a single phy
was created at a time. However, if multiphy new phys were detected in
a short amount of time, the logic would get confused and try to process
phys that have not been probed yet. Fix this by only processing the wiphy
and related interfaces when the filtered dump is performed, and not any
additional ones that might still be pending.
